So, I guess it's nothing new when I say that LS is not much about trading and all the best items are kept by leading guilds, BUT
- people are still selling something worthy, right?

The only problem is that all those nice items which are for sale are not on the MP.
Why? For sure one of the reasons is that upfront fee. The second (but actually the first) would be the fact, that there are not enough players, so there is no point to place an item, pay the fee and have it expired, right?

So, why not have it the way where we can place more items for better prices (more items overall!) and not worry that they will find no buyer and expire?
How about we place our item over and over again and the buyer finally shows up, buys the item for the full price and nice fee is being paid?

How about any time we check MP we see something interesting, something for a different (bigger) price than 19.99 fg?


I find that upfront fee as the final nail in the coffin for the MP. Pretty much none of us will put all the items on the MP, because we know that it's better to find a buyer first and once the buyer is found we often sell it for 1 fg to avoid paying the fee.

If we don't need to worry about the upfront fee, we will be more willing to put more items for bigger prices on the MP. I think that should work way better for njaguar too.

(Just in case / tl;dr version: fee would still apply, but after the item is sold)

With last update you can relist the same item at the same price before it expires without paying the fee again; so as long as you update it you only pay the fee once. I don't really mind the upfront fee; I think it helps discourage people from listing trash at exorbitant prices
